Concept:
  • A greenhouse is a glass building that provides optimum temperature for plants to grow in cold climates.
  • The glass traps the heat inside to keep it warm.
  • Greenhouse gases act in a very similar way for our atmosphere in trapping the heat.
  • These gases present in the atmosphere absorbs the infrared radiation and re-emits the heat back to the surface.
  • 50% of the heat is lost to space and rest 50% comes back to the Earth's surface.
  • This keeps the average temperature of Earth inhabitable.
  • This phenomenon is called greenhouse effect

Important Points

  • The primary greenhouse gases include:
    • water vapour
    • carbon dioxide (CO2)
    • methane (CH4)
    • nitrous oxide (N2O)
  • Various human activities like burning of fossil fuels has led to a significant increase of greenhouse gases in the atmosphere over the past two centuries.
  • This has in turn led to the global warming which is a global concern for life on Earth.
  • Global warming causes increase in global average temperature, melting of polar ice, increase of sea-level, etc.

Additional Information

  • Oxygen (O2) may indirectly cause greenhouse effect by forming ozone (O3) in the lower atmosphere, which may then act as a secondary greenhouse gas.
